System Setup

In order to setup the system for your news system, you will need to login to your System Administrator account. You may login by visiting the admin directory via your web browser, such as http://www.yourdomain.com/admin/ and logging in to the system. After you are logged in, you will be presented with the administration control panel.

When you enter the administration control panel, you will see a list of links in the left hand column. This section of the manual deals with the "Manage System" section of your control panel. After clicking the "Manage System" link, you will be presented with the setup for your news system.

Only System Admininistrators are able to view this section of the admin panel.

There are several different settings on this screen, which will control the overall behavior of the news.

The first few options, the Page title, Meta-Keywords and Meta Description setup the title and meta tags for the HTML pages generated by the application.

The "Main page where news is embedded" should contain the URL to the page where you are displaying the news at. This should be a complete URL, as it is used to create links back to the main news page. If you are embedded the news in a web page with an IFRAME, you need to enter the URL to that page, not the url to the news script itself.

The "Language" selector will allow you to define which language to show the news prompts in.

The news system gives you the choice to allow visitors to your web site the ability to post articles to the news system. If this is enabled, you will see a link at the bottom of your news program labeled "submit news". If you wish, you may force users to create an account before they submit any news article, or you may allow them to post the articles anonymously. Lastly, you may choose whether you wish to preview and approve articles which are submitted, or allow them to be posted immediately to the system. If you choose to preview the articles before they are shown live, they will appear as "Pending Articles" in the Manage News section of the admin panel.

The BosNews script will allow you to choose if you wish visitors to have an option of posting comments on your articles. You may also choose to preview and approve comments on your articles, before they are posted live. If you choose to preview the comments, they will appear as "Pending Comments" in the Manage Comments section of the admin panel.

The "From email address" is used when sending emails to users, such as the account creation, and account verification emails. Please make sure to enter a valid email address within this box.

The news system allows you to prevent users from creating accounts based upon the users email address. If you wish to prevent users from registering accounts with for example Yahoo! or HotMail accounts, you may enter "@yahoo.com" or "@hotmail.com" into the "Banned email addresses" box. If you wish to prevent a specific email address such as "spammer@yahoo.com" you may enter their full email address into the box. Separate each enter with a space, example:

"@yahoo.com @hotmail.com joe@spammer.com".
